最新回答 / 海耶森斯
把jdbc.properties里面的username=root,改成user=root,然后spring-dao.xml里面也改成${user},用username的話好像就直接用你的計算機用戶名當做mysql數據庫名登錄去了
2018-01-24
測試queryAll提示參數綁定錯誤,然后debug很久,解決了。。。萬萬沒想到啊,視頻接著往下就是告訴你這個bug是故意埋的?。。?!
2018-01-20
WARNING: An illegal reflective access operation has occurred
2018-01-17
c3p0
初始化連接數
<property name="initialPoolSize" value="5"/>
連接的最大空閑時間
<property name="maxIdleTime" value="20"/>
自動超時回收
<property name="unreturnedConnectionTimeout" value="25"/>
mysql6.0.6
jdbc.driver=com.mysql.cj.jdbc.Driver目錄已改
url加上&useSSL=false&serverTimezone=UTC 是否使用SSL 指定時區
初始化連接數
<property name="initialPoolSize" value="5"/>
連接的最大空閑時間
<property name="maxIdleTime" value="20"/>
自動超時回收
<property name="unreturnedConnectionTimeout" value="25"/>
mysql6.0.6
jdbc.driver=com.mysql.cj.jdbc.Driver目錄已改
url加上&useSSL=false&serverTimezone=UTC 是否使用SSL 指定時區
2018-01-16
c3p0
<!--初始化連接數-->
<property name="initialPoolSize" value="5"/>
<!--連接的最大空閑時間 -->
<property name="maxIdleTime" value="20"/>
<!-- 自動超時回收 -->
<property name="unreturnedConnectionTimeout" value="25"/>
mysql6.0.6
jdbc.driver=com.mysql.cj.jdbc.Driver目錄已改
url加上&useSSL=false&serverTimezone=UTC 是否使用SSL 指定時區
<!--初始化連接數-->
<property name="initialPoolSize" value="5"/>
<!--連接的最大空閑時間 -->
<property name="maxIdleTime" value="20"/>
<!-- 自動超時回收 -->
<property name="unreturnedConnectionTimeout" value="25"/>
mysql6.0.6
jdbc.driver=com.mysql.cj.jdbc.Driver目錄已改
url加上&useSSL=false&serverTimezone=UTC 是否使用SSL 指定時區
2018-01-16
這里寫的是:LIMIT #{offset} , #{limit},但是之前老師的 offset 寫的是 offet
2018-01-11
<= 是因為<是轉義符號,可以使用&lt;替代,比寫<![CDATA[ <= ]]>要簡潔些。
2018-01-08
相比H,M更簡潔,既然H拋棄不了HQL,那何不直接寫原生的SQL呢?不過這又把程序員跟數據庫拉近了,以前可能不需要太關心數據庫,是有數據庫層面的優化可能不太關心,或者說H幫你做了一部分。我覺得M更適合業務發展比較快,數據庫、表、字段有頻繁的更新,隨時需要更新SQL語句的情況,如果用H的話你需要改動好幾個地方,而M只需要改動JavaBean和xxMapper.xml了,其它根本不用動。
2018-01-08